Abstract

MARS-h was developed in order that it could be applied to the thermal hydraulic safety analysis of HANARO operating at low pressure and low temperature conditions. To assess the prediction capability of MARS-h, validation calculations were performed against available experimental data of HANARO and other research reactor. The results of validation calculation showed that the developed MARS-h can appropriately be used for analyzing the thermal hydraulic transient of HANARO.
